Pakistan to host SAFF Football Championship 2020

Published on: April 12, 2018 5:03 AM

LAHORE: Pakistan will host SAFF Football Championship 2020, an official of the Pakistan Football Federation said on Wednesday. It appears that with the restoration of Pakistan Football Federation’s membership by the FIFA, the doors for international football tournaments in Pakistan have also opened as the South Asian Football Federation has allowed Pakistan to host three regional tournaments between 2019 and 2021.

“The Congress meeting of South Asian Football Federation has approved Pakistan as host of South Asian Football Championship in 2020,” added the PFF official. “Pakistan will also host South Asian Under-15 Boys Championship in 2019 and Under-19 Women’s Championship in 2021,” the official said. PFF’s President Faisal Saleh Hayat has hailed the decision saying that it is a big success of PFF following its restoration by the FIFA. “The struggling period of Pakistan Football is over now,” Hayyat said in a statement.

Meanwhile, Pakistan’s Khadim Ali Shah has been elected as vice president of South Asian Football Federation for next four years. SAFF includes seven regional countries including Pakistan, Bangladesh, India, Bhotan, Nepal, Sri Lanka and Maldives.
